Talent.com
This job offer is not available in your country.
Principal Software Development Engineer - Platform Development (AWS / Azure)

Principal Software Development Engineer - Platform Development (AWS / Azure)

AutodeskBengaluru, Karnataka, India
12 hours ago
Job description

Position Overview

As a Principal Software Development Engineer, you will join the Engineering & DevOps Services (EDS) team within AI, Data & Automation (AIDA) at Autodesk. Our team drives the Enterprise AI Strategy by building and operationalising the Enterprise AI Fabric , enabling intelligent search, LLM-powered workflows, and AI-driven agents across Autodesk. Our team has a lot of visibility and the impact of our work is directly related to Autodesk business results. We value the culture, transparency and collaboration in our team and at Autodesk in general, we take pride in our global diversity and how we work and talk with one another. This is a hybrid role based in Bengaluru, India.

Job Description :

We are looking for a highly skilled Principal Software Development Engineer (SDE-IV) to lead the development and operationalisation of AI Platforms. This role combines hands-on engineering with platform ownership, ensuring the successful implementation of tools and frameworks that enable intelligent search, LLM-powered actions, and AI-driven productivity agents across the organisation.

You will play a pivotal role in designing, building, and deploying AI-enabled solutions that integrate with enterprise collaboration platforms and intranet websites. As a senior engineer, you will also guide junior developers, influence architectural decisions, and ensure scalability, security, and adoption of enterprise AI tools.

Responsibilities

Technical Excellence & Engineering

  • Demonstrate deep expertise in areas such as cloud infrastructure, distributed systems, and event-driven architectures
  • Design and evolve large-scale, reliable, and secure systems with a focus on performance, maintainability, and operational excellence
  • Stay hands-on when needed—prototyping, debugging, and delivering high-impact components
  • Apply deep platform development expertise in AWS Cloud, including caching, load balancing, auto-scaling, database redundancy and resiliency, performance monitoring, hosting patterns, and full-stack platform architecture across all layers

Platform Engineering & Architecture

  • Build foundational platforms and shared services that enable rapid development and innovation across multiple teams
  • Design systems for extensibility, multi-tenancy, and future growth — not just immediate product requirements
  • Champion reusable “building blocks” over siloed point solutions
  • Drive adoption of AI Agent Platforms, working with emerging standards like MCP, embedding Trusted AI governance, and enabling LLM-powered actions across enterprise systems
  • Strategic & Business Alignment

  • Connect technical decisions to broader business goals (e.g., cost optimization, customer impact, faster time to market)
  • Prioritize initiatives based on a balance of technical merit and strategic business value
  • Influence product direction through a strong technical voice in cross-functional forums
  • Technical Leadership

  • Lead through influence and expertise across diverse engineering teams
  • Drive architectural decisions, mentor senior engineers, and contribute to a culture of engineering rigor and excellence
  • Facilitate knowledge sharing, tech strategy reviews, and cross-team collaboration
  • Systems Thinking & Complex Problem Solving

  • Approach challenges holistically, considering code, infrastructure, team dynamics, and business context
  • Navigate ambiguity and deliver clarity through well-thought-out decisions and forward-looking designs
  • Balance short-term execution with long-term system health and scalability
  • Cross-Functional Communication & Collaboration

  • Communicate clearly and effectively with technical and non-technical audiences, from engineers to executives
  • Adapt communication styles to suit the audience — technical deep dives vs. strategic roadmaps
  • Build strong partnerships with Product, Infrastructure, Security, and Business teams
  • Execution & Results Delivery

  • Own delivery from concept through deployment and adoption — ensuring business and customer impact
  • Decompose complex initiatives into actionable work across teams, ensuring high-quality execution
  • Lead cross-team engineering programs with clarity, accountability, and alignment
  • Adaptability & Continuous Learning

  • Stay current on evolving technologies, best practices, and industry trends
  • Encourage experimentation and innovation in tools, architecture, and engineering processes
  • Foster a team culture grounded in curiosity, learning, and continuous improvement
  • Minimum Qualifications

  • 10+ years of professional software development experience, including deep expertise in building and scaling distributed systems, cloud-native platforms (AWS, Azure, or GCP), and event-driven architectures
  • Proven platform development experience in AWS Cloud across caching, load balancing, auto-scaling, database redundancy / resiliency, performance monitoring, hosting patterns, and full-stack platform architecture
  • Expertise in Python (or similar modern programming languages) with experience delivering scalable, production-grade systems
  • Demonstrated ownership of end-to-end system design, development, and operational excellence for critical production systems
  • Strong understanding of security best practices, observability (monitoring, logging, alerting), and reliability engineering principles
  • Experience in designing and evolving AI / LLM-driven platforms, including AI Agent Platforms, MCP, Trusted AI governance, and LLM-enabled enterprise actions
  • Proven ability to design and evolve foundational platforms that accelerate development across multiple business units
  • Demonstrated ownership of initiatives from idea to production launch, with measurable business or customer impact
  • Experience working across multiple technical domains (e.g., backend, cloud infrastructure, security, data engineering, automation, CI / CD) and demonstrated ability to quickly ramp up on new technologies
  • Experience leading cross-functional initiatives and collaborating with product, security, operations, infrastructure, and business teams
  • Ability to solve ambiguous, complex problems by considering technical, business, and organizational perspectives
  • Excellent communication and influencing skills with the ability to engage diverse technical and non-technical stakeholders, including senior leadership
  • Experience mentoring senior engineers and fostering a culture of engineering excellence
  • Bachelor’s degree in Computer Science, Engineering, or related technical field (or equivalent practical experience)
  • Preferred Qualifications

  • Experience in participating or driving "Tech Culture" initiatives like Engineering Excellence and Reliability Programs
  • Master’s degree in Computer Science or a related technical discipline
  • Experience in building AI and Machine Learning solutions, with practical exposure to AI Agent Platforms, Trusted AI, and LLM-enabled automation
  • Experience scaling systems to users or high-throughput enterprise environments
  • Contributions to open-source projects, technical publications, or speaking at major industry events
  • Hands-on experience with modern DevOps practices, CI / CD pipelines, and infrastructure as code (IaC)
  • #LI-RV1

    Learn More

    About Autodesk

    Welcome to Autodesk! Amazing things are created every day with our software – from the greenest buildings and cleanest cars to the smartest factories and biggest hit movies. We help innovators turn their ideas into reality, transforming not only how things are made, but what can be made.

    We take great pride in our culture here at Autodesk – it’s at the core of everything we do. Our culture guides the way we work and treat each other, informs how we connect with customers and partners, and defines how we show up in the world.

    When you’re an Autodesker, you can do meaningful work that helps build a better world designed and made for all. Ready to shape the world and your future? Join us!

    Salary transparency

    Salary is one part of Autodesk’s competitive compensation package. Offers are based on the candidate’s experience and geographic location. In addition to base salaries, our compensation package may include annual cash bonuses, commissions for sales roles, stock grants, and a comprehensive benefits package.

    Diversity & Belonging

    We take pride in cultivating a culture of belonging where everyone can thrive. Learn more here :

    Are you an existing contractor or consultant with Autodesk?

    Please search for open jobs and apply internally (not on this external site).

    Create a job alert for this search

    Software Development Engineer • Bengaluru, Karnataka, India

    Related jobs
    • Promoted
    • New!
    Principal Software Engineer, Distributed Cloud

    Principal Software Engineer, Distributed Cloud

    F5Bengaluru, Karnataka, India
    At F5, we strive to bring a better digital world to life.Our teams empower organizations across the globe to create, secure, and run applications that enhance how we experience our evolving digital...Show moreLast updated: 12 hours ago
    • Promoted
    • New!
    Software Principal Engineer

    Software Principal Engineer

    Dell TechnologiesBengaluru, Karnataka, India
    Software Principal Engineer (I8).PowerScale, a Gartner Magic Quadrant leader in Unstructured Data Storage and Management is evolving by re-architecting its stack to cater to the unique demands of t...Show moreLast updated: 12 hours ago
    • Promoted
    • New!
    Principal Software Engineer

    Principal Software Engineer

    MicrosoftBengaluru, Karnataka, India
    Our team in Azure GenAI is at the cutting edge of developing large language model technologies to power Azure AI Platform products and offering them as a service for both internal and external appl...Show moreLast updated: 12 hours ago
    • Promoted
    • New!
    Principal Software Engineer - GenAI

    Principal Software Engineer - GenAI

    Commonwealth BankBengaluru, Karnataka, India
    At CommBank, we never lose sight of the role we play in other people’s financial wellbeing.Our focus is to help people and businesses move forward to progress. To make the right financial decisions ...Show moreLast updated: 12 hours ago
    • Promoted
    • New!
    Principal Platform Engineer

    Principal Platform Engineer

    Commonwealth BankBengaluru, Karnataka, India
    At CommBank, we never lose sight of the role we play in other people’s financial wellbeing.Our focus is to help people and businesses move forward to progress. To make the right financial decisions ...Show moreLast updated: 12 hours ago
    • Promoted
    • New!
    Software Development Engineer II, Fulfillment by Amazon (FBA)

    Software Development Engineer II, Fulfillment by Amazon (FBA)

    ADCI - KarnatakaBengaluru, Karnataka, India
    How would you build the next generation of mission critical systems and services that power the ability to send, store and manage billions of products across the globe on behalf of our selling part...Show moreLast updated: 12 hours ago
    • Promoted
    • New!
    Principal Software Engineer

    Principal Software Engineer

    SyniverseBengaluru, Karnataka, India
    Syniverse is the world’s most connected company.Whether we’re developing the technology that enables intelligent cars to safely react to traffic changes or freeing travelers to explore by keeping t...Show moreLast updated: 12 hours ago
    • Promoted
    • New!
    Senior Platform Engineer

    Senior Platform Engineer

    GlobalHunt India Pvt. Ltd.Bengaluru, Karnataka, India
    Strong passion for building, deploying, and operating high-quality software and platform solutions.Have experience in core AWS services like EC2, VPC, S3, Identity and Access Management (IAM), Lamd...Show moreLast updated: 12 hours ago
    • Promoted
    • New!
    Sr. Software Development Engineer, Digital Acceleration

    Sr. Software Development Engineer, Digital Acceleration

    Amazon Development Centre (India) Private LimitedBengaluru, Karnataka, India
    Do you thrive on solving complex problems with simple solutions? Would you like to drive innovation for Amazon's Digital Businesses influenced by Gen AI solutions? Join Amazon Digital Acceleration ...Show moreLast updated: 12 hours ago
    • Promoted
    • New!
    Software Principal Engineer - C, C++, UNIX

    Software Principal Engineer - C, C++, UNIX

    Dell International Services India Pvt Ltd (7451)Bengaluru, Karnataka, India
    The Software Engineering team delivers next-generation application enhancements and new products for a changing world.Working at the cutting edge, we design and develop software for platforms, peri...Show moreLast updated: 12 hours ago
    • Promoted
    • New!
    Principal Software Engineer

    Principal Software Engineer

    DiligentBengaluru, Karnataka, India
    Diligent is the global leader in modern governance, providing SaaS solutions across governance, risk, compliance, audit and ESG. Empowering more than 1 million users and 700,000 board members and le...Show moreLast updated: 12 hours ago
    • Promoted
    • New!
    Principal Software Engineer (Hybrid in Bangalore)

    Principal Software Engineer (Hybrid in Bangalore)

    SmartsheetBengaluru, Karnataka, India
    For over 20 years, Smartsheet has helped people and teams achieve–well, anything.From seamless work management to smart, scalable solutions, we’ve always worked with flow.We’re building tools that ...Show moreLast updated: 12 hours ago
    • Promoted
    Principal Software Engineer

    Principal Software Engineer

    OracleBengaluru, Karnataka, India
    Joining Oracle will give you the opportunity to design and build innovative new systems from the ground up and operate services at scale. Engineers at every level can have significant technical and ...Show moreLast updated: 30+ days ago
    • Promoted
    • New!
    Principal Software Engineer 1

    Principal Software Engineer 1

    Visteon CorporationBengaluru, Karnataka, India
    At Visteon, the work we do is both relevant and recognized—not just by our organization, but by our peers, by industry-leading brands, and by millions of drivers around the world.And, as a truly gl...Show moreLast updated: 12 hours ago
    • Promoted
    • New!
    Software Development Engineer, DaS FinTech

    Software Development Engineer, DaS FinTech

    ADCI - KarnatakaBengaluru, Karnataka, India
    Amazon Devices and Services Fintech is the global team that designs and builds the financial planning and analysis tools for wide variety of Amazon’s new and established organisations.From Kindle t...Show moreLast updated: 12 hours ago
    • Promoted
    • New!
    Software Development Engineer III, Digital Acceleration

    Software Development Engineer III, Digital Acceleration

    ADCI - KarnatakaBengaluru, Karnataka, India
    Interested in solving hard technical problems that have a direct impact on our business and customers? Do you enjoy the challenge of figuring out scalable and reusable technical solutions in the co...Show moreLast updated: 12 hours ago
    • Promoted
    Principal Software Engineer

    Principal Software Engineer

    VerintBengaluru, Karnataka, India
    At Verint, we believe customer engagement is the core of every global brand.Our mission is to help organizations elevate Customer Experience (CX) and increase workforce productivity by delivering C...Show moreLast updated: 30+ days ago
    • Promoted
    • New!
    Principal Software Engineer(Analytics)

    Principal Software Engineer(Analytics)

    RingCentralBengaluru, Karnataka, India
    We are looking for a Senior Backend and Infra Engineer that will work on a variety of exciting projects with responsibility for designing and delivering secure, distributed, scalable and fault tole...Show moreLast updated: 12 hours ago
    • Promoted
    • New!
    Software Development Engineer II, Amazon

    Software Development Engineer II, Amazon

    ADCI - KarnatakaBengaluru, Karnataka, India
    Interested in solving hard technical problems that have a direct impact on our business and customers? Do you enjoy the challenge of figuring out scalable and reusable technical solutions in the co...Show moreLast updated: 12 hours ago
    • Promoted
    • New!
    Principal Software Engineer

    Principal Software Engineer

    Cadence Design Systems, Inc.Bengaluru, Karnataka, India
    At Cadence, we hire and develop leaders and innovators who want to make an impact on the world of technology.The company applies its underlying Intelligent System Design strategy to deliver softwar...Show moreLast updated: 12 hours ago